LLCC swept its final two matches of its tournament in Peoria with a convincing 25-14, 25-6, 25-14 win over Southwestern Illinois and an ensuing three set sweep of South Suburban College. Against the Cougars of SWIC, the Loggers came out fast, seizing a quick lead and building it to 14-7 behind hitting from Talesha Scott and passing by Kendall Knop and Izzy Carroll. In the second game, it was all Loggers as Reinthaler and Carroll served SWIC off the court, building a 21-4 lead. The Loggers then cruised in the third game as well. "We played well start to finish," Coach Dietz said. "We limited our errors and it's the first match in quite a while where we've been focused from first to last."

The Loggers then played South Suburban where a team effort defeated SSC. "SSC is undermanned right now because of injuries which hurts them, but they are a great defensive team. They made us earn our points throughout the contest. I thought Kendall Knop did well hitting and we got good passing from several people including Kaley Hennings and Brook McKinney. Now we have to move our focus to Wednesday and our Region 24/MWAC match with Lincoln."
